Why Exterior Building Evaluations Matter

Routine evaluations are critical for ensuring the longevity and safety of your building. The exterior of a property endures constant exposure to environmental elements such as wind, rain, sun, and fluctuating temperatures. Over time, these factors can lead to wear and tear that compromises structural integrity and functionality. Regular evaluations help property owners and managers:

Identify Structural Issues Early

Small problems, such as cracks in the facade or minor leaks, can evolve into significant issues if left unaddressed. Routine inspections allow professionals to spot these problems early, saving you time and money in the long run.

Maintain Safety Standards

A well-maintained exterior is crucial for ensuring the safety of occupants and visitors. Loose materials, such as bricks or glass, can pose a serious hazard if they detach from the building. Regular evaluations ensure that all components are securely in place.

Preserve Property Value

The condition of your building’s exterior has a direct impact on its market value. A clean, well-maintained facade enhances curb appeal, which is essential for attracting tenants or buyers. Routine maintenance helps preserve and even enhance the value of your investment.

Comply with Regulations

Many local regulations and building codes require property owners to perform periodic evaluations of their building’s exterior. Staying compliant not only avoids potential legal issues but also demonstrates your commitment to safety and professionalism.

Key Areas of Focus During Evaluations

During a routine exterior building evaluation, several critical areas are inspected to ensure the building’s integrity and safety. These include:

Facade Inspection

The facade is the most visible part of your building and often the first to show signs of wear. Evaluations focus on detecting cracks, discoloration, or other damage to materials such as brick, stone, stucco, or glass. Identifying these issues early can prevent further deterioration.

Roofing Systems

Your roof plays a vital role in protecting the building from weather-related damage. Routine evaluations check for leaks, missing shingles, or pooling water that could indicate underlying problems.

Windows and Doors

Windows and doors are crucial for energy efficiency and security. Inspections assess the condition of seals, frames, and glass for any damage or gaps that could lead to air or water infiltration.

Drainage Systems

Effective drainage is essential for preventing water damage. Evaluations ensure that gutters, downspouts, and other drainage components are clear of debris and functioning properly.

Foundation and Structural Elements

The foundation and load-bearing structures are inspected for cracks, settlement, or other signs of stress. These assessments ensure the building’s stability and longevity.

Benefits of Hiring Professionals for Exterior Building Evaluations

While some property owners may attempt DIY inspections, professional evaluations offer several advantages. Certified experts possess the knowledge, experience, and tools necessary to conduct thorough assessments. Here’s why hiring professionals is the best approach:

Comprehensive Assessments

Professionals have the expertise to identify issues that may not be immediately visible to the untrained eye. Their detailed evaluations provide a clear picture of your building’s condition.

Advanced Tools and Techniques

Professional evaluators use specialized equipment, such as drones, thermal imaging cameras, and moisture meters, to detect hidden problems. These tools enable accurate and efficient inspections.

Tailored Maintenance Plans

After completing an evaluation, professionals can provide customized recommendations for maintenance and repairs. These plans prioritize tasks based on urgency and budget, helping you make informed decisions.

Long-Term Cost Savings

By addressing issues early, professional evaluations can help you avoid costly emergency repairs or replacements. Investing in routine maintenance pays off in the long run by extending the life of your building’s components.

Best Practices for Routine Exterior Evaluations

To maximize the benefits of exterior building evaluations, follow these best practices:

Schedule Regular Inspections

Establish a consistent schedule for evaluations based on your building’s age, materials, and exposure to environmental factors. Annual or bi-annual inspections are typically recommended.

Document Findings

Maintain detailed records of each evaluation, including photographs and written reports. This documentation is invaluable for tracking changes over time and planning future maintenance.

Act Promptly on Recommendations

When issues are identified, address them promptly to prevent further damage. Delaying repairs can lead to more significant problems and higher costs.
